CSS特殊值*,\ 0 /

时间:2011-11-30 07:10:53

标签: css

我看到一个带*的代码,\ 0 /我只是想知道它意味着什么?我猜他们与某些特定的浏览器有关吗?

.form_element select
{
   padding:4px;
   *padding:0px;
   padding:0px \0/;
}

4 个答案:

答案 0 :(得分:6)

\0/定位到IE8及以下版本,并显示在值

之后
#id
{ padding: 0px \0/; }

*定位到IE7及以下版本,并直接显示在属性

之前
#id
{ *padding: 0px; }

_定位到IE6及以下版本,并直接显示在属性

之前
#id
{ _padding: 0px; }

答案 1 :(得分:5)

欢呼的男人(\0/)是一个IE8 + 9 CSS黑客。

明星黑客(*),不一定是*#也可以),是IE6 + 7黑客。

答案 2 :(得分:2)

答案 3 :(得分:0)

这是IE8, IE9检查此http://paulirish.com/2009/browser-specific-css-hacks/

的黑客攻击
#div  {color: blue\0/;} /* must go at the END of all rules */